Summer 2008. A new record from an original and exciting musical force…THE MUSIC.
Strength
In Numbers, the bands third album, will be released through Yes Please
/ Polydor on June 16th 2008. The 12 track album, recorded in late 2007
by uber producers Flood (Killers / U2) and Paul Hartnoll (ex Orbital)
has already set forums ablaze with news of one of the comebacks of the
year. Consistently one of the most incendiary live bands in the UK, the
Leeds-based band, released their much-acclaimed self-titled debut album
in 2002 before following up with Welcome To The North, their second
long player in 2004. Despite worldwide sales in excess of one million
albums, headlining festivals as far a field as Japan and Australia and
stadium shows alongside the likes of U2, Oasis and Coldplay, outside
pressures took their toll on the band forcing them to reconsider life
as The Music. Deciding they would “have to make an amazing record or
bust” they holed up with Flood and Hartnoll in London’s Townhouse
Studios coming up with their strongest album to date. Aggressive and
confident, yet fresh and forward thinking, Strength In Numbers blends
guitars and electronics to produce a sound that is sonically unlike
anything else in 2008.
